[Zimbabwe] Chinese Influence Grows As Zimglass Gets A Leg-Up

Zimglass Ind is set to resuscitate its National Glass subsidary which has been lying idle for months through strategic alliances with Chinese firm Jingniu (Zimbabwe Investments) Ltd, which will come in as a technical partner. Jingniu is a medium-sized glass manufacturing company, which is developing its own multi-million-dollar factory adjacent to the Zimglass factory. National Glass is a subsidary of Zimglass Industries, which is a wholly-owned subsidary of the Industrial Development Corp (IDC) of Zimbabwe Ltd. "Plans are underway to resuscitate the plant. Jungniu has been engaged to assist the Zimglass team in the technical redesigning of the plant to determine whether we can use the current infrastructure to suit the new plant design," confirmed IDC public relations manager Mr Derek Sibanda. The plant is expected to produce around 220/tpd float glass.
